For the Innovation Center to be successful
it is essential that there is a proactive approach to partnership development with the private
sector.
PROBLEM
Public and academic institutions often devote little resources to sales activities and operate in a
reactive mode. To successfully reorientate MOME Innovation Centre towards private market, its
important a adopt a proactive approach to business development.

Potential failures
that can undermine the success of MOME Innovation centre
1
Proclaiming transformation but failing to act accordingly, incl. but not limited to
•
Claiming focus on private collaboration, but not proactively seeking partnerships,
•
Claiming focus on social impact and sustainability, but not enforcing such policy on the grounds
(not recycling, overusing plastic, priority for cars, etc.),
•
Claiming thought leadership, but not being able to communicate research & project results in a
simple way.
2
Focusing on rapid transformation without sensitive and meaningful inclusion of the Innovation
centre people:
•
High chance of damaging the organization’s overall morale and team’s confidence;
•
Does not promote interest in adopting transformation and new routines.
